BeGreen said:The greenhouse is home built from scratch using windows and doors from our 2006 house remodel. If the wife is interested, there are less expensive routes to take. The ground cloth is heavy-duty, commercial, nursery landscape fabric. It's much tougher than the ordinary, big box stuff.
It's 10x24'. Our old Jotul 602 is in the greenhouse for supplemental heat, but it hasn't been fired up this year so far. I have 5 dark garbage cans filled with water that helps stabilize the temps a bit too. We couldn't attach the greenhouse with our house layout, but my sister has an attached greenhouse that is designed to supplement house heat. It does a nice job of keeping the house warm when it's sunny outside. With R10 glass, it also holds the heat pretty well overnight.
